Using the journey map

Overview

A Journey Map is the canvas where you build, compare, and organize Journeys.

image.png

Key features:

  • Add multiple Journeys to one map

  • Mix Journey types

  • See conversion on different paths

  • Click nodes to open screen details

Managing multiple journeys

You can duplicate Journeys, compare versions, or use different settings for each.

Cohort filters on journeys

Global filters

Applied at the map level. Affect all Journeys.

Useful for:

  • High-level audience comparisons

  • Broad user segmentation

Journey-level filters

Applied inside the Journey settings.

Useful for:

  • Comparing two versions of the same Journey

  • Narrowing analysis to a specific cohort

Examples of multiple journey comparisons to make

New vs old product flow

To measure the difference between a new onboarding journey (or any older product journey) to an old one you would:

  1. Create a journey for your new flow (custom journey could work best if its linear)

  2. Click the purple starting node of the journey and then click duplicate or cmd + d.

  3. On the duplicated journey, click the purple starting node and change the time frame to before the new experience was released.

  4. Confirm the changes with 'Update for everyone'.

You will now be able to see the same journey but across two different time ranges.

Note: If you've changed the URLs that the new experience appears on, you're duplicated journey might have empty nodes. In this scenario, it would be best to create another custom journey.

Comparing the conversion rates between different regions

To measure how a journey is performing in different regions you would:

  1. Create a journey for your flow (the journey type will depend on what you want to learn).

  2. Click the purple starting node of the journey and then click duplicate or cmd + d.

  3. On the duplicated journey, click the purple starting node and change the region to the one you are interested in.

  4. Confirm the changes with 'Update for everyone'.

You will now be able to see the same journey but across two different regions.

Comparing the conversion rates between different user groups

This comparison will work if you are using a custom cohort for user groups. You can learn more in our Cohorts documentation. To compare the user groups, you would:

  1. Create a journey for your flow (the journey type will depend on what you want to learn).

  2. Click the purple starting node of the journey and then click duplicate or cmd + d.

  3. On the duplicated journey, click the purple starting node and change the cohort value to the one you are interested in.

  4. Confirm the changes with 'Update for everyone'.

You will now be able to see the same journey but across different user groups.
